LA State Highway 165 between city limits and the Ouachita River Bridge, in front of the chemical plants
Speed limit drops sharply from 55 to 30 mph, police car usually concealed behind bushes or buildings. Tickets have been written for less than 10 mi. over limit. It’s possible out-of-state plates (this is near the Arkansas line) and likely out-of-towners are special targets. I have observed other motorists who couldn’t have been going very fast being pulled over, and have had a relative who said he was going right at 40 mph pulled over before he could slow down after noticing the posted limit change.
